I've ordered coins from Monnaie de Paris, and once had to pay a hospital bill after I departed France. They accepted a US
personal check (with a slight amount extra, to cover conversions to Euros.) In most instances the check cleared as quickly as a local check.
This may also work: Purchase a 50 Euro travelers check, and in the "pay to" line, place the name of the payee, and send it by "regular" mail--I've used this with Swiss Franc TC's with success--assuming the payee is not a crook.
